High school wrestling coach arrested

A 30-YEAR-OLD walk-on wrestling coach at Marina High School was arrested Friday on a charge of having unlawful sex with a minor (Shutterstock).

A 30-year-old walk-on wrestling coach at Marina High School in Huntington Beach was arrested Friday (today) for having an “alleged inappropriate sexual relationship” with a student at MHS.

According to Capt. Tim Martin, HBPD officers arrested Kevin Rayford of Seal Beach for unlawful sexual acts with a minor. He was booked into Huntington Beach Jail.

“Marina High School staff and [Huntington Beach Union High] district staff acted swiftly in notifying us of the allegations against Rayford and are fully cooperating with the investigation,” said Martin. “At this time the investigation into this case is still ongoing and no further details will be released.”

Police believe there might be other victims and anyone with more information regarding this case is asked to contact Detective Sean McCollom at smcollom@hbpd.com.
